Yong Siew Toh Conservatory, National University of Singapore and the Elder Conservatorium of Music, University of Adelaide present a unique, live, online and cross-cultural collaboration featuring leading Australian didgeridoo performer William Barton, and supported by an eclectic mix of performers from both Conservatories, including erhu, tabla and saxophone in addition to the typical orchestral instruments. This innovative new work has been co-composed by composition students Connor Fogarty, Heng Li, Teresa di Fava and Likie Low and will be performed simultaneously in two geographic locations over 5000km apart. The work represents a meaningful cultural exchange between our two countries and aims to reflect our respective cultures. Despite our differences in geographical size, Singapore and Australia have many points in common, including our relatively close physical proximity and our positioning in the burgeoning economies of Asia. This performance is supported by the Australia Singapore Arts Group.
